Dinner Recipes

Delicious Thai Beef Salad Recipe – Fresh & Flavorful Delight

0 comments

If you’re craving a fresh, vibrant meal that brings the essence of Thailand to your kitchen, look no further than this Thai Beef Salad. Bursting with flavor and texture, this dish combines perfectly cooked beef with crisp vegetables, fragrant herbs, and a zesty dressing that elevates every bite. The key to its appeal lies in the balance of savory, sweet, and tangy elements that make it not only satisfying but also incredibly refreshing. sweet pepper salad This salad is perfect for warm days or when you want something light yet filling. In just under 30 minutes, you can prepare a wholesome meal that’s suitable for any occasion—whether it’s a casual weeknight dinner or an impressive dish for entertaining guests. With its colorful presentation and robust flavors, this Thai Beef Salad is sure to become a favorite in your household.

Why You’ll Love This Thai Beef Salad

For more inspiration, check out this marry me chicken pasta recipe.

  • Quick and Easy: Minimal prep time and straightforward steps make this recipe stress-free, even for novice cooks
  • Flavorful and Versatile: Enjoy outstanding flavor with ingredients you can easily customize by adding your favorites or adjusting spices
  • Healthy and Nutritious: Packed with protein from beef and loaded with fresh vegetables, this salad offers a balanced meal option

Ingredients for Thai Beef Salad

Here’s what you’ll need to make this delicious dish:

  • Sirloin Steak: Choose a well-marbled cut for tenderness; you’ll need about one pound for optimal flavor
  • Mixed Greens: A combination of lettuce, spinach, and arugula provides both crunch and nutrition
  • Cucumber: Use a fresh cucumber for added crunch; slice it thinly to blend well with other ingredients
  • Cherry Tomatoes: These sweet tomatoes add color and juiciness; halving them makes them easier to eat
  • Cilantro: Fresh cilantro gives the salad a fragrant finish; use generously for authentic flavor

For the Dressing:

  • Lime Juice: Freshly squeezed lime juice adds acidity; aim for about two tablespoons for the best taste
  • Fish Sauce: This umami-rich ingredient is essential in Thai cooking; use sparingly as it’s quite potent
  • Sugar: A touch of sugar balances the acidity; brown sugar works particularly well here

The full ingredients list, including measurements, is provided in the recipe card directly below.

Recipe preparation

How to Make Thai Beef Salad

Follow these simple steps to prepare this delicious dish:

Step 1: Prepare the Beef

Start by seasoning your sirloin steak with salt and pepper. Heat a grill pan over medium-high heat and cook the steak for about 4-5 minutes per side until it reaches your desired doneness. Transfer to a cutting board to rest before slicing.

Step 2: Slice the Vegetables

While the beef is resting, slice the cucumber into thin rounds and halve the cherry tomatoes. Rinse the mixed greens under cold water to ensure they are crisp before drying them thoroughly using a salad spinner or paper towels.

Step 3: Make the Dressing

In a small bowl, whisk together lime juice, fish sauce, sugar, and a pinch of black pepper until combined. Adjust seasoning according to taste if needed.

Step 4: Assemble the Salad

In a large bowl, combine mixed greens, sliced cucumber, cherry tomatoes, and chopped cilantro. Toss gently to mix all ingredients evenly without bruising them.

Step 5: Add Sliced Beef

Once rested, slice the beef thinly against the grain. Add it on top of the salad mixture along with any juices from the cutting board to enhance flavor.

Step 6: Drizzle Dressing Over Top

Finally, pour your prepared dressing over the salad just before serving to maintain freshness. Toss everything lightly so that all components are coated in dressing.

Transfer to plates and drizzle with sauce for the perfect finishing touch.

Tips and Tricks

Here are some helpful tips to ensure the best results for your dish:

  • Even Cooking: Make sure all ingredients are cut to similar sizes for consistent cooking times
  • Temperature Control: Let ingredients reach room temperature before starting for better results
  • Advanced Technique: For enhanced flavor, try marinating the beef in lime juice and fish sauce for up to an hour before cooking

How to Serve Thai Beef Salad

This Thai Beef Salad is versatile and pairs wonderfully with:

  • Rice or Potatoes: A hearty base that soaks up the delicious sauce. Korean chicken rice bowl.
  • Fresh Salad: Adds a crisp and refreshing contrast to the rich flavors of the dish.
  • Crusty Bread: Perfect for enjoying every last drop of the flavorful sauce.

Feel free to pair it with your favorite sides for a personalized meal!

Make Ahead and Storage

  • Make Ahead: You can prepare the beef and salad components in advance. Marinate the beef for at least 30 minutes before grilling. Slice vegetables and herbs ahead of time, storing them in airtight containers in the fridge for up to 3 days.
  • Storing: Leftover Thai Beef Salad should be stored in an airtight container in the refrigerator. It can last for up to 3 days. Keep the dressing separate if possible, as this helps maintain freshness.
  • Reheating: To reheat, warm the beef in a skillet over medium heat for about 5 minutes until heated through. Avoid overheating as it may dry out. Serve with fresh salad ingredients after reheating for best texture.

Suggestions for Thai Beef Salad :

Choose the Right Cut of Beef

Selecting the correct cut of beef is crucial for a flavorful Thai Beef Salad. Opt for tender cuts like sirloin or flank steak, as they cook quickly and remain juicy. Avoid tougher cuts, such as chuck or round, as they can become chewy when grilled or pan-seared. quick pickled red onions Additionally, marinating the beef enhances its flavor and tenderness. A simple marinade made from soy sauce, lime juice, and garlic works wonders. Remember to let the beef rest after cooking to retain its juices before slicing it thinly against the grain.

Balance Your Flavors

A key component of an authentic Thai Beef Salad is the balance of flavors: sweet, salty, sour, and spicy. Make sure to use fresh herbs like cilantro and mint to add brightness to the dish. Incorporate ingredients like fish sauce or palm sugar for umami and sweetness. Overloading on one flavor can lead to an unbalanced dish that lacks depth. Taste your dressing regularly during preparation to achieve that perfect harmony of flavors that defines a great Thai Beef Salad.

Use Fresh Ingredients

Fresh ingredients make a significant difference in your Thai Beef Salad’s taste and presentation. Whenever possible, choose seasonal vegetables such as bell peppers, cucumbers, and cherry tomatoes. These ingredients not only provide vibrant colors but also add a crucial crunch to your salad. refreshing cucumber salad Dried herbs or wilted vegetables lack the freshness essential for this dish. Always wash and properly store your produce before using them to ensure maximum flavor and texture.

Don’t Forget the Textures

Texture plays a vital role in creating an enjoyable Thai Beef Salad experience. Combine crunchy vegetables with tender beef slices for contrast. Add roasted peanuts or crispy shallots on top for added crunch. Avoid making your salad too soft or mushy by overcooking the beef or using soggy vegetables. The right mix of textures elevates your dish and keeps each bite exciting.

FAQs :

What is a traditional dressing for Thai Beef Salad?

The dressing for a traditional Thai Beef Salad typically includes lime juice, fish sauce, sugar, chili flakes, and minced garlic. This combination brings together the essential flavors of Thailand: sour from lime, salty from fish sauce, sweet from sugar, and heat from chili flakes. Adjusting these components allows you to customize the dressing according to your taste preferences while keeping it authentic.

Can I prepare Thai Beef Salad in advance?

Yes! Preparing Thai Beef Salad in advance can enhance its flavors as they meld together over time. However, it’s best to keep certain elements separate until serving time—specifically the dressing and fresh vegetables—to maintain their texture and taste. Store cooked beef in an airtight container in the refrigerator; just remember to toss everything together just before serving for optimum freshness.

Is there a vegetarian version of Thai Beef Salad?

Absolutely! You can create a delicious vegetarian version of Thai Beef Salad by substituting beef with grilled tofu or tempeh for protein. Use similar seasonings found in traditional recipes while incorporating fresh vegetables such as carrots, bell peppers, and edamame beans for added texture and nutrients. This modification keeps the essence of the dish while catering to plant-based diets. For more inspiration, check out this beef and pepper rice bowls recipe.

How do I store leftover Thai Beef Salad?

To store leftover Thai Beef Salad properly, place it in an airtight container in the refrigerator. Keep the dressing separate until you’re ready to eat again; this prevents the salad from becoming soggy. Leftovers should ideally be consumed within two days for optimal freshness and flavor retention. When reheating any components like beef or tofu, avoid overheating them as this can affect their texture.

Conclusion for Thai Beef Salad :

In summary, creating an unforgettable Thai Beef Salad hinges on several key factors: choosing the right cut of beef is essential to ensure tenderness while balancing flavors enhances overall taste. Fresh ingredients contribute significantly to both flavor and presentation; thus focusing on quality is vital. Additionally, paying attention to texture can elevate your salad into a delightful culinary experience that excites every palate. By avoiding common mistakes such as using tough meat or overpowering flavors, you can master this vibrant dish that showcases the rich tapestry of Thai cuisine beautifully.

Print

Thai Beef Salad

5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

Experience the vibrant flavors of Thailand with this Thai Beef Salad. This refreshing dish features perfectly seared sirloin steak, crisp mixed greens, and a zesty dressing that balances savory, sweet, and tangy notes. Ready in just 30 minutes, it’s an ideal meal for warm days or a light yet satisfying dinner. Impress your family or guests with this colorful and nutritious salad that packs a punch in every bite.

  • Author: Alexa
  • Prep Time: 15 minutes
  • Cook Time: 10 minutes
  • Total Time: 25 minutes
  • Yield: Serves 4
  • Category: Salad
  • Method: Grilling
  • Cuisine: Thai

Ingredients

Scale
  • 1 lb sirloin steak
  • 4 cups mixed greens (lettuce, spinach, arugula)
  • 1 medium cucumber (thinly sliced)
  • 1 cup cherry tomatoes (halved)
  • ½ cup fresh cilantro (chopped)
  • 2 tbsp lime juice (freshly squeezed)
  • 1 tbsp fish sauce
  • 1 tsp brown sugar

Instructions

  1. Prepare the Beef: Season the sirloin steak with salt and pepper. Heat a grill pan over medium-high heat and cook the steak for about 4-5 minutes per side until desired doneness. Let it rest before slicing.
  2. Slice the Vegetables: Thinly slice the cucumber and halve the cherry tomatoes. Rinse mixed greens under cold water and dry well.
  3. Make the Dressing: In a small bowl, whisk together lime juice, fish sauce, sugar, and a pinch of black pepper until well combined.
  4. Assemble the Salad: In a large bowl, combine mixed greens, cucumber, tomatoes, and cilantro. Toss gently to mix.
  5. Add Sliced Beef: Slice the rested beef against the grain and place it over the salad mixture.
  6. Drizzle Dressing: Pour dressing over salad just before serving and toss lightly to coat.

Nutrition

  • Serving Size: 1 cup (approximately 250g)
  • Calories: 320
  • Sugar: 3g
  • Sodium: 680mg
  • Fat: 18g
  • Saturated Fat: 7g
  • Unsaturated Fat: 10g
  • Trans Fat: 0g
  • Carbohydrates: 18g
  • Fiber: 4g
  • Protein: 25g
  • Cholesterol: 75mg

Did you make this recipe?

Share a photo and tag us — we can't wait to see what you've made!

Leave a Comment

Your email address will not be published. Required fields are marked *

*

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star